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
50830 57161429800 50
34 59553382579
34 59553382579
76171402 91 28385634 304017 49105170669
All about undefined
Interested in learning more?
34 59553382579
76171402 91 28385634 304017 49105170669
See more
9489109 854642598 45615200963
36 12664 70735477890 011
See more
2161684 548482921 00369551199
97447 822 22901950
See more